## Break-glass: Pictoscrub EXIF pipeline

Reviewers normally never need production access to Pictoscrub, our EXIF-scrubbing service. If a privacy incident demands inspecting raw uploads before scrubbing, use the break-glass role — it is logged and auto-expires after one hour. Activation happens through the Hollowfen console, which requires the break-glass recovery passphrase recorded on the following line.

unlock words, hahip-baduf: holwyn-istath-julvan

### Runbook: Report export timezone mismatches (Glimmerfield)

If a customer reports that exported totals differ from the dashboard, check whether their report schedule predates the March cutover — older schedules still render in server-local time rather than the account timezone. Re-saving the schedule fixes it. Before escalating, confirm the export worker is running with the expected timezone settings shown below.

config for kadup-kajog:
[raldor]
host = raldor.tolvaqworks.internal
user = raldor_svc
database = raldor_prod

Q: The Sheafline CSV import wizard is stuck on "validating headers" — what now? A: Usually a stale schema cache. Flush the cache from the admin panel, retry the import, and check the mapper logs. If the wizard's saved-mapping store is corrupted, restore it from the sealed backup. The restore passphrase appears below.

vault phrase of kahof-kawig = casax-holius-gordor-druiel

Welcome aboard! Before you cut your first release of Beaconline, know that all telemetry payloads get compressed with our in-house `squishpak` codec before shipping to the collector. It saves us roughly 70% on egress and keeps the ingest tier happy. The important bit for you: releases must bump the codec version flag in the manifest, or old agents will choke. The step-by-step checklist, including rollback notes, is on the internal release page.

dashboard of bahaf-tageg = https://jira.zemvarlabs.internal/projects/projects/browse/projects